Affordable Bikes You Can Find Around the World

1. Bajaj CT 100 – The Cheapest Bike in India

If you live in India and want a very affordable bike, the Bajaj CT 100 is an excellent option. It is one of the cheapest bikes in India and is known for its great fuel efficiency and simple design. This bike is perfect for people who need an affordable ride for daily commuting. Even though it’s cheap, it’s built to last and will serve you well for years.

2. Hero HF Deluxe – Affordable and Reliable

Another great option is the Hero HF Deluxe. This bike is known for being affordable but still reliable. It’s designed to handle daily rides without breaking the bank. It’s fuel-efficient, meaning you won’t spend too much money on gas. The Hero HF Deluxe is a great bike for anyone looking for a low-cost option that still offers solid performance.

3. TVS Star City Plus – Cheap and Efficient

The TVS Star City Plus is another affordable bike that provides excellent fuel economy. It’s perfect for people who want a reliable bike for everyday use. The Star City Plus is built to last and is designed to give you smooth rides without high maintenance costs. It’s one of the cheapest bikes you can buy in India while still getting good value for your money.

Things to Consider When Buying the Cheapest Bike

1. What Do You Need the Bike For?

Before buying a bike, think about how you’ll use it. Do you need it for commuting to work? Or maybe for weekend trips? Knowing what you need will help you choose the right bike that fits your lifestyle.

2. Fuel Efficiency

When you’re looking for a cheap bike, make sure it’s fuel-efficient. Many affordable bikes like the Bajaj CT 100 and Hero HF Deluxe are designed to save you money on fuel. A bike with good mileage means you won’t spend too much on gas, helping you save more money in the long run.

3. How Durable Is the Bike?

Even if a bike is cheap, it should still be durable. Look for bikes made with good materials that will last over time. A cheap bike should still give you value for your money and not break easily. 4. Safety Features

Don’t forget safety! Even when looking for the cheapest bike, make sure it comes with safety features like good brakes and tires. Safety should always come first, no matter the price.
